mirror of
https://github.com/usmannasir/cyberpanel.git
synced 2025-11-15 17:56:12 +01:00
possible fix of https://community.cyberpanel.net/t/snappymail-does-not-show-email-folders-for-subdomain-domain-com-websites/40026
This commit is contained in:
@@ -1351,9 +1351,9 @@ autocreate_system_folders = On
|
|||||||
if lines.find('[plugins]') > -1:
|
if lines.find('[plugins]') > -1:
|
||||||
PluginsActivator = 1
|
PluginsActivator = 1
|
||||||
WriteToFile.write(lines)
|
WriteToFile.write(lines)
|
||||||
elif PluginsActivator and lines.find('enable = '):
|
elif PluginsActivator and lines.find('enable = ') > -1:
|
||||||
WriteToFile.write(f'enable = On\n')
|
WriteToFile.write(f'enable = On\n')
|
||||||
elif PluginsActivator and lines.find('enabled_list = '):
|
elif PluginsActivator and lines.find('enabled_list = ') > -1:
|
||||||
WriteToFile.write(f'enabled_list = "mailbox-detect"\n')
|
WriteToFile.write(f'enabled_list = "mailbox-detect"\n')
|
||||||
PluginsActivator = 0
|
PluginsActivator = 0
|
||||||
else:
|
else:
|
||||||
|
|||||||
@@ -574,13 +574,15 @@ $cfg['Servers'][$i]['LogoutURL'] = 'phpmyadminsignin.php?logout';
|
|||||||
labsDataLines = open(labsPath, 'r').readlines()
|
labsDataLines = open(labsPath, 'r').readlines()
|
||||||
PluginsActivator = 0
|
PluginsActivator = 0
|
||||||
WriteToFile = open(labsPath, 'w')
|
WriteToFile = open(labsPath, 'w')
|
||||||
|
|
||||||
|
|
||||||
for lines in labsDataLines:
|
for lines in labsDataLines:
|
||||||
if lines.find('[plugins]') > -1:
|
if lines.find('[plugins]') > -1:
|
||||||
PluginsActivator = 1
|
PluginsActivator = 1
|
||||||
WriteToFile.write(lines)
|
WriteToFile.write(lines)
|
||||||
elif PluginsActivator and lines.find('enable = '):
|
elif PluginsActivator and lines.find('enable = ') > -1:
|
||||||
WriteToFile.write(f'enable = On\n')
|
WriteToFile.write(f'enable = On\n')
|
||||||
elif PluginsActivator and lines.find('enabled_list = '):
|
elif PluginsActivator and lines.find('enabled_list = ') > -1:
|
||||||
WriteToFile.write(f'enabled_list = "mailbox-detect"\n')
|
WriteToFile.write(f'enabled_list = "mailbox-detect"\n')
|
||||||
PluginsActivator = 0
|
PluginsActivator = 0
|
||||||
else:
|
else:
|
||||||
|
|||||||
Reference in New Issue
Block a user